Edmonton's cap situation is pretty well handled. Hall/RNH/Eberle are signed to nearly identical 6m contracts that expire one at a time a few years down the road. One of the very few things Tambellini did right (and every asshole around the league said they were awful contracts, now every team is doing long term extensions for guy's second contracts if they're stars). Klefbom is locked up long term pretty cheap, if he is truly a top pairing or very good second pairing guy. Hard to say what happens with guys like McDavid, Nurse, Reinhart, Draisatl and so on but the Hall/RNH/Eberle contracts are almost sort of an internal cap.

It's still a really flawed team on the back end. But hopefully after Nurse is done beating the shit out of the AHL for a month or two that will really help solidify things. Unfortunately Fayne is not the player anyone thought he was, and that contract goes for another 2 seasons after this one. Sekera's looked shaky as well. Basically the Oilers have two pretty decent second pairing guys (Klefbom and Sekera), then a mix of third pairing/power play guys (Fayne, Schultz, Ference, Davidson, Gryba). Reinhart is doing fairly well, but I doubt his ceiling is much higher than second pairing either. It'll be interesting to see if any of the expensive veterans (Fayne, Ference, Nikitin) get shipped out later in the year after injuries start hitting. Over 10m a year locked up in those three guys alone.

The entire "fancy stats" community was saying that the Flames were a fluke last year. I don't 100% buy in to fancy stats, but I think they do have some value. Calgary's PDO (combined shooting and save percentage) were pretty sky high last year. Reversion to the mean was going to happen. I don't think that the Flames have nearly as good of goaltending as the Habs, Rangers, Lightning or Capitals do. And two of those teams have far better offense as well. So their PDO's might be legit. The Flames got some hot/lucky goaltending and pretty spectacular puck luck shooting wise to add up to a very good PDO that was probably a bit of an illusion.
